Gibbons Walk is in South Shields and in South Tyneside district. NE34 9LP is located in the Biddick and All Saints elect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South Shields.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ding NE34 9LP is primarily male, with 53.5% of the population being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around NE34 9LP,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 43.5%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Safety

Is Gibbons Walk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Gibbons Walk was 138.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 19.0% higher than the Bede average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Gibbons Walk has the 38th highest crime rate of 108 local areas in Bede and the 123rd highest crime rate of 523 local areas in South Tyneside .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 47.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-79.9%.
